At time t1 (decimal hours), each Besselian element is evaluated by:

a = a0 + a1*t + a2*t2 + a3*t3  

where: a = x, y, d, l1, l2, or μ; t = t1 - t0 (decimal hours), and t0 =  18.000 TDT.
